Enjoying Digital Photography

This group is for Digital Photographers that not only want to share thier work, but want to discuss and learn from each other to make the experience more rewarding. We will have some 'Tech Tips' from time to time and Q&A is very much encouraged.

Photo Category May 14-22 - Transportation

Let's get out there and capture some images of different modes of transportation. It doesn't have to be just planes, trains, and automobiles. Make it interesting. A photo of a car or bike doesn't have to include the entire subject. Get creative! Interesting hub cab on that car? Shoot it! Let's see how many different types of transportation we can find. Spring contest in Better Photography

Have you taken a photo of something that you consider proof that "Spring has Sprung"? We want to see it! This contest is open to everyone, whether you belong to a photo group or not. Sue Bloom, the founder of the Photography group, will be the judge for this contest, and of course, her decisions will be final. Thank you Sue!

There are two categories; Beginner view link and Amateur view link Eons is offering a Grand Prize and two Runner-Up prizes for each category. The Grand Prizes will be Musical CDs and some Eons swag! The Runners-Up will each receive Eons swag (Eons swag includes T-shirts, mugs, mouse pads and so on).

So, get those cameras out and start snapping - - Spring HAS sprung so let's see what you got! Contest begins on Sunday May 11, 2008 and ends on Saturday May 24, 2008 at 11:59 pm EST. Here's a link to the Better Photography group even if you want to go and wander thru the posted photos! view link

Here are the official rules:

1. Photos will be posted in a two special threads located in the Better Photography group. Post your photo in either the Beginner or Amateur thread.
2. The theme is "A Sure Sign of Spring".
3. Only one entry per person. The work must belong to the person entering the photo.
4. Photos must be taken this year.
5. Photos can be color or black and white.
6. Minimal photo enhancement is permitted ie. cropping, sharpening, etc.
7. A very brief explanation of the photo can be posted if desired.
8. Contest will last two weeks to give all Eons members time to capture their very best photos.
9. Decisions of the judge are final.
